  • Slavery, Family, And Gentry Capitalism In The British Atlantic
  • Written by author S.D. Smith
  • Published by Cambridge University Press, July 2008
  • From the mid-seventeenth century to the 1830s, successful gentry capitalists created an extensive business empire centered on slavery in the West Indies, but inter-linked with North America, Africa, and Europe. S. D. Smith examines the formation of this B
  • A study of the British Atlantic World through a case study of the plantation-owning Lascelles.
